Midlothian Heritage had already won two in a row and they went ahead and made it three on Friday. They were the clear victor by a 3-0 margin over the Red Oak Hawks.

One reason for the win was Midlothian Heritage's dynamic defense, which allowed fewer and fewer points in every set they played. The match finished with set scores of 25-21, 25-19, 25-18.

Midlothian Heritage's win ended a four-game drought on the road and puts them at 16-18. As for Red Oak, their loss ended a six-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 20-14.

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Midlothian Heritage will venture away from home to square off against Crandall at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Red Oak, they will head out on the road to challenge Corsicana at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Red Oak is looking to tack on another W to their three-game streak on the road.
